Official abstract text for this publication.
A vehicle is provided that includes a frame and a mount to couple a first end of an apparatus to the frame. The apparatus comprises a central region that includes a first energy-absorbing material. A first side of the central region is included in the first end of the apparatus coupled to the frame. The apparatus comprises a side region that includes a second energy-absorbing material. The side region is positioned along a second side of the upper region. The side region is configured to be positioned above a wheel of the vehicle.

What is claimed is: 1. A vehicle comprising: a frame; an apparatus coupled to the frame at a first end of the apparatus, wherein the apparatus extends from one side of the vehicle to an opposite side of the vehicle, and wherein the apparatus comprises: a central region of the apparatus that includes a first energy-absorbing material, wherein a first side of the first energy-absorbing material is included in the first end of the apparatus coupled to the frame, and a side region of the apparatus that includes a second energy-absorbing material positioned outside the central region to overlap in contact with a second side of the first energy-absorbing material other than the first side, wherein the first energy-absorbing material is positioned outside the side region, wherein the second energy-absorbing material is positioned to overlap above a wheel of the vehicle, and wherein the first energy-absorbing material and the second energy-absorbing material have different material characteristics; and a mount to couple the apparatus with the frame. 2. The vehicle of claim 1 , wherein the first energy-absorbing material of the central region has a first hardness that is less than a second hardness of the second energy-absorbing material of the side region. 3. The vehicle of claim 1 , wherein the apparatus further comprises a bumper that includes a third energy-absorbing material, wherein the bumper is positioned at a second end of the apparatus opposite to the first end, and wherein a third side of the first energy-absorbing material opposite to the first side is included in the second end of the apparatus where the bumper is positioned. 4. The vehicle of claim 3 , wherein the apparatus further comprises a protruding structure positioned below the bumper and at the second end of the apparatus. 5. The vehicle of claim 4 , wherein the protruding structure includes a fourth energy-absorbing material having a hardness that is greater than a given hardness of the third energy-absorbing material in the bumper. 6. The vehicle of claim 1 , wherein the apparatus further comprises a removable energy-absorbing material positioned below the first energy-absorbing material, wherein the removable energy-absorbing material includes wiring for connectivity between the frame and one or more electronic devices included in the apparatus. 7.
